| Comment: | The command-line "diff" does not ignore whitespace at the end of lines and it generates a well-formed patch file that can be fed directly into "patch -p 0". Ticket [a9f7b23c2e376af]. GUI diffs and the merge commands do ignore end-of-line whitespace. |

163 164 165 166 167 168 169 | ** and pPivot => pV2 (into aC2). Each of the aC1 and aC2 arrays is ** an array of integer triples. Within each triple, the first integer ** is the number of lines of text to copy directly from the pivot, ** the second integer is the number of lines of text to omit from the ** pivot, and the third integer is the number of lines of text that are ** inserted. The edit array ends with a triple of 0,0,0. */ | | | | 163 164 165 166 167 168 169 170 171 172 173 174 175 176 177 178 |
** and pPivot => pV2 (into aC2). Each of the aC1 and aC2 arrays is
** an array of integer triples. Within each triple, the first integer
** is the number of lines of text to copy directly from the pivot,
** the second integer is the number of lines of text to omit from the
** pivot, and the third integer is the number of lines of text that are
** inserted. The edit array ends with a triple of 0,0,0.
*/
